Additional Information for Mine Dispersing System Control Box
A Mine Dispersing System Control Box is a component of a mine dispersing system used in military operations. It is classified under the supply class Miscellaneous Weapons, which falls under the supply group Weapons.
The control box is responsible for managing and controlling the deployment of mines in a minefield. It typically includes various controls, switches, and indicators that allow the operator to arm, disarm, and activate the mine dispersing system.
The control box is designed to be durable and resistant to harsh environmental conditions, as it is often used in combat situations. It is an essential component in ensuring the safe and effective deployment of mines for defensive or offensive purposes.
